The Lowdown on the CTA: Not Quite Hogwarts' Room of Requirement

Ireland and the UK are part of a nifty little club called the Common Travel Area (CTA). Think of it as a travel BFF zone, where you can bounce between the two countries with minimal fuss. But here's the catch: visas are like invitations to a specific friend's house party. An Irish visa is an invite to the Dublin bash, not the London shindig.

BIVS: Your Ticket to a Two-Country Tellython (with a Twist)

Now, there's a wrinkle called the British-Irish Visa Scheme (BIVS). This fancy term basically means if your Irish visa is BIVS-approved (it'll be stamped on there), then you can swing by London after your Irish adventure. But there's a crucial detail: you gotta enter Ireland first. It's like party etiquette, you wouldn't gatecrash your friend's mate's party, would you?

So, Can You Visit London with an Irish Visa? Maybe, Maybe Not...

Here's the shortbread:

  • Plain Irish Visa: No London for you, unless you fancy a visa application redo.
  • BIVS-Approved Irish Visa: London awaits, but only after a pitstop in Ireland (think of it as a pre-game to the main event).

Important Note: Always Double-Check!

Visa rules can be trickier than a leprechaun's jig. Before you book your flight, make sure you understand the specifics of your Irish visa. Is it BIVS-approved? Check that visa stamp! If you're unsure, contact the Irish embassy or consulate for clarification.
